Antivirus software programs attempt to identify, neutralize or eliminate malicious software. The term "antivirus" is used because the earliest examples were designed exclusively to combat computer viruses; however most modern antivirus software is designed to combat a wide range of threats, including worms, phishing attacks, rootkits and Trojans, often described collectively as malware.
